What is WAW? A brain child of Eric Peterson, WAW events are an opportunity for folks interested in Web analytics to meet face to face informally and chat about analytics (or not). WAW's began in early 2005 and are held around the world at 6 pm local time. (Frequently asked questions about WAW are here.)
